#eda166 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eda166 is composed of 92.9% red, 63.1%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.1% magenta, 57%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 26.2 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 66.5%. #eda166 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ffcc with #db4300.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#eda166 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eda166 has RGB values of R:237, G:161,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.32, Y:0.57,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15573350.

Shades and Tints of #eda166
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050201 is the darkest color, while #fef7f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#eda166
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aba9a8 is the less saturated color, while #fa9f59 is the most saturated one.
